Introduction to Event Prop Making
Event Prop Making involves the design, creation, and installation of props and decorative elements that enhance the overall aesthetic and theme of an event. This can include anything from custom-built stage sets to intricate decorative pieces. The goal of Event Prop Making is to create an immersive environment that engages attendees and leaves a lasting impression.
Key Elements of Event Prop Making
- Design and concept development
- Material selection and sourcing
- Construction and installation
- Lighting and special effects
Applications of Event Prop Making
Event Prop Making has a wide range of applications across various industries, including corporate events, weddings, theater productions, and exhibitions. The use of custom props and decorative elements can help to create a unique and memorable experience for attendees, setting an event apart from others in its class.
Examples of Event Prop Making Applications
- Corporate events: custom stage sets, decorative elements, and branding materials
- Weddings: custom decorative pieces, wedding arches, and centerpieces
- Theater productions: set design, prop creation, and special effects
- Exhibitions: custom display stands, decorative elements, and interactive exhibits
